Monster Cards

To properly identify and value Yu-Gi-Oh Monster Cards, you need to understand their unique attributes and abilities.

Monster card attributes play a crucial role in determining their strength and effectiveness in battles. These attributes include their Level, Attack Points (ATK), and Defense Points (DEF). Higher levels usually indicate stronger monsters, while ATK and DEF determine their offensive and defensive capabilities, respectively.

Fusion monsters, on the other hand, are a special type of Monster Cards that can be created by combining two or more specific monsters. These powerful creatures possess a fusion symbol and can often provide unique abilities or benefits in duels.

Understanding the attributes and abilities of Monster Cards, including fusion monsters, is essential for assessing their value and creating a formidable deck that can dominate your opponents.

Spell Cards

To properly assess the value and understand the significance of Spell Cards in Yu-Gi-Oh, familiarize yourself with their unique effects and strategic advantages. Spell Cards are an essential part of any deck, allowing you to manipulate the game state and gain an advantage over your opponent. There are different types of spell cards, each with its own purpose and function. Here is a table highlighting three common types of spell cards and their effects:

Spell Card Type Effect
Normal Provides a one-time effect when activated.
Continuous Remains on the field and provides a continuous effect.
Quick-Play Can be activated during either player's turn, offering versatility.

To use spell cards effectively, consider the current game state and plan your moves accordingly. Timing is crucial, so be mindful of the right moment to activate your spell cards for maximum impact. Additionally, make sure to include a balanced mix of spell cards in your deck to ensure versatility and adaptability in various situations.

Trap Cards

Now let's shift our focus to Trap Cards, another crucial element in the world of Yu-Gi-Oh.

Trap Cards are powerful tools that can turn the tide of a duel in your favor. Here are some common trap card strategies to help you dominate your opponents:

  1. Counter Traps: These trap cards are designed to negate your opponent's moves, giving you a chance to gain control of the duel.
  2. Continuous Traps: These trap cards remain on the field, providing ongoing effects that can disrupt your opponent's strategies and protect your own monsters.
  3. Trap Monsters: These unique trap cards can be summoned as monsters to surprise your opponent and catch them off guard.
  4. Trap Hole Variants: These trap cards are designed to destroy your opponent's monsters when they're summoned, removing threats from the field.

Extra Deck Cards

Extra Deck cards, also known as Fusion, Synchro, and Xyz cards, are an integral part of the Yu-Gi-Oh card game.

Fusion and Synchro cards in the extra deck allow you to summon powerful monsters by combining specific monsters from your hand or field. These cards often have unique abilities and higher attack or defense points, making them crucial in turning the tide of the game.

Understanding the mechanics of Xyz and Link cards is equally important. Xyz cards require you to stack monsters with the same level to summon an Xyz monster, while Link cards focus on creating Link Summons by connecting different zones on the field.

How Can I Determine the Rarity of a Yu-Gi-Oh Card?

To determine the rarity of a Yu-Gi-Oh card, you can look for indicators like the card's edition, set symbol, and holographic foil. These factors can help you assess its value accurately.
